The AirTAC GC30015MC2 AirTAC F.R.L. Combination, PT1/2, Manual Drain is a genuine G-series three-unit F.R.L. combination: a separate filter, a separate regulator and a separate lubricator assembled as one air-preparation station. It has PT1/2" ports, a 40 µm element, a manual drain and regulates 0.05 - 0.9 MPa (7 - 130 psi).
The GC30015MC2 is an AirTAC GC-series three-unit F.R.L. combination: a separate air filter, pressure regulator and lubricator assembled as one package. This configuration is sized 300 with a PT1/2 port, carries the standard 40 um filter element for water and particulate removal, uses a manual drain on the filter bowl (polycarbonate at this size), and has a standard regulator adjustable from 0.05 to 0.9 MPa (7-130 psi) with a round psi gauge fitted. The lubricator feeds oil mist downstream to keep air tools and cylinders running smoothly.
This is a genuine AirTAC part. The GC family is offered in sizes 200, 300, 400 and 600 with a choice of ports and threads, filter grade 40 um standard or 5 um (code W), manual, automatic or differential-pressure drains, gauge type and scale, and a reverse/check valve option. Max inlet pressure is 1.0 MPa (145 psi) and the working temperature range is -5 to 70 C (non-freezing). Specifications follow the official AirTAC G-series air-preparation data. The regulating band is set by the drain type: automatic and differential-pressure drains regulate 0.15 - 0.9 MPa, a manual drain regulates 0.05 - 0.9 MPa. Standard type, regulating 0.05 - 0.9 MPa (7 - 130 psi). The combination has no separate bracket code — the three units couple together with their own mounting hardware. | GC300 | G-series F.R.L. combination, 300 body — sets the port range. |
|---|---|
| 15 | Port size PT1/2". This body offers 08 = PT1/4", 10 = PT3/8", 15 = PT1/2". |
| M | Drain: Manual drain — this also sets the regulating band (0.05 - 0.9 MPa (7 - 130 psi)). |
| (blank) | Standard type. Blank is standard, L is the low-pressure type. |
| (blank) | Pressure gauge fitted (blank). |
| C | Gauge shape: Round. C is round, F is square. |
| 2 | Gauge scale: psi. 1 is MPa, 2 is psi, 3 is bar. |
| (blank) | Filtering grade 40 µm. Only 40 µm (blank) and 5 µm (W) exist. |
| (blank) | PT thread. PT is the default; G is BSPP and T is NPT. |
| (blank) | No reverse-flow valve (the default). |
Field order is size, port, drain, type, gauge, shape, scale, grade, thread, reflux — there is no bracket position on a combination. Constituent units, orderable separately as spares: GF300-15 filter, GR300-15 regulator and GL300-15 lubricator.
A GC is three separate units, so the filter and the regulator can each be serviced or replaced on their own. A GFC is the two-unit set, where filtering and regulating share one body — shorter, but the two functions come as one part. Both filter, regulate and lubricate.

Feeds filtered, regulated and lubricated air to the machine tool's clamping fixtures, tool changers and pneumatic actuators, with the psi gauge giving operators a visible setpoint at the machine.
Prepares the air line serving spray guns and air-assisted equipment in a body shop: water and particulate removed at 40 um, pressure held steady by the regulator, and oil mist delivered downstream.
Supplies the carton sealers, diverters and pick-and-place cylinders on a packaging conveyor line, keeping moisture and debris out of the valves while the lubricator protects the cylinders.
Start with the port step: this unit is size 300 with a PT1/2 port; step up to size 400 or 600 if your line needs more flow capacity, or down to 200 for compact circuits. Choose the drain to match how the unit is attended: this code has a manual drain (drained by hand), while automatic and differential-pressure drains are available for unattended installations. Filter grade is the standard 40 um here; specify 5 um (code W) where finer particulate removal matters. The gauge on this code is a round gauge with a psi scale; embedded square gauges and MPa or bar scales are the other catalogue options. Thread is PT as standard, with G (BSPP) and NPT available to order as specifications.

The PC bowls must not be cleaned with solvents — wipe them with a dry cloth. The lubricator adds an oil mist downstream of the regulator. If any branch of the line must stay oil-free, take that branch off before the lubricator, or use a GR300-15 regulator with a GF300-15 filter on that branch.

The M in GC30015MC2 specifies a manual drain, meaning the filter bowl is drained by hand as part of routine maintenance. If the unit will be installed where nobody drains it regularly, the same size is available with an automatic or differential-pressure drain - just ask for the alternative code.
